Key Highlights

  • 1Equinix reported robust revenue growth across its Americas, EMEA, and Asia-Pacific segments, with total revenues reaching $9.217 billion for the year ended December 31, 2025.
  • 2The company opened 16 new data centers in 2025 across 35 metros, expanding its global footprint to 280 data centers and signaling continued aggressive expansion.
  • 3Annualized Gross Bookings reached $1.6 billion in 2025, a 27% increase year-over-year, reflecting strong customer demand and the successful capture of this demand across its platform.
  • 4Equinix achieved 96% renewable energy coverage globally in 2024 (with 2025 data pending), demonstrating a strong commitment to sustainability and environmental responsibility.
  • 5The company continued to execute on its capital allocation strategy, raising $4.4 billion in capital to support organic growth, acquisitions, and debt refinancing.
  • 6Equinix surpassed 500,000 interconnections on its platform, reinforcing its position as a critical hub for digital ecosystems and enabling direct, secure connections for its customers.
  • 7The company's financial performance was strong, with Net Income increasing by 66% to $1.348 billion and Adjusted EBITDA growing by 11% to $4.530 billion in 2025.

Equinix's revenue growth in 2025 was primarily driven by incremental revenues from IBX data center expansion projects completed within the year and an increase in orders from both existing and new customers across all geographic segments. The company's strong recurring revenue model and its ability to capture demand in a growing digital infrastructure market were also key contributors.

Key risks identified include macroeconomic uncertainties such as power cost increases and supply chain disruptions, potential failures in physical infrastructure, cybersecurity threats, competition in the data center market, challenges in leasing and renewing data center leases, and the complexities of managing a global operation. The company also faces risks related to its capital structure, including substantial debt, and the potential impact of geopolitical events.

Equinix is actively positioning itself to capitalize on AI demand. This includes designing new IBX data centers to support power and cooling needs twice that of previous centers, investing in xScale data centers through joint ventures to serve hyperscale companies, and noting AI as a catalyst for ecosystem acceleration. The company is building an AI ecosystem of model providers, data platforms, and gateways.

Equinix's sustainability strategy, 'Future First,' focuses on minimizing environmental impact while enabling the digital economy. Key initiatives include a commitment to 100% clean and renewable energy coverage for its global portfolio, reducing greenhouse gas emissions with approved science-based targets, improving energy efficiency (measured by PUE), and investing in green finance. The company also provides customers with Green Power Reports and Customer Water Reports.
